Culdaff Climbfest 2009 - Féile Dhreapadóireachta Chúl Dabhcha 2009

Climbfest 2009 will be on 2nd, 3rd and 4th May 2009.
There will be a mess tent and a barbeque will be provided though you must bring your own grub.

The second Culdaff Climbfest took place on 28th April to 1st May 2006. Logbook Reports of the Climbfest

The 2008 Climbfest took place on 4th, 5th and 6th of May 2008.

As usual the meeting place will be McGrorys (excellent food, music and Guinness), and free camping is available at Bunagee, behind the pier. There are several hundred single pitch routes, mainly in the middle grades, at Dunmore Head, Dunowen, Kinnego Bay, Galavoir, Warm Bay Point, Malin Head and Port a Doris, most of which are convenient to the road. There is also excellent bouldering at Dunaff.

Bring your bucket, spade and surf board, as this little known and most northerly part of Ireland has fine "Blue Flag" beaches and good surf. Bring the kids, why not? Colmcille Climbers will be on hand to guide you to and tell you about the crags. Last year we had 100+ participants, and hope to build on that in 2009, making this an annual event, and the natural place to kick off your year's activities on the rock.
